The difference between consulates found in Aqaba are the level of powers and size of these consulates. Some consulates are
the bigger consulate-general and usually can assist in a wide scope of consular matters. Other smaller consulates are often manned by private
citizens and are called honorary consulates. These honorary consulates often have limited powers and do not issue visas or passports.
All consulates of Slovenia in Jordan besides Aqaba
Honorary Consulate of the Republic of Slovenia in Amman, Jordan - 147 - King Abdullah 2nd Street - P.O.Box 455 - Amman 11821 - JordanEmail: consul.slo@leaders.com.jo - Tel: (+962) 79 8 500 507 (mobile) - Website:
Or the embassy of Slovenia in Jordan
(There is no embassy of Slovenia located in Jordan)
